Comprehending Composite Doors

Before diving into the renovation process, it's vital to comprehend what composite doors are and why they require unique attention. Composite doors are made from a combination of materials, consisting of wood, PVC, and insulating foam, which provides them strength and resilience. Unlike traditional wood doors, composite doors do not warp, crack, or swell, making them an ideal option for homeowners.

Benefits of Composite Doors

  • Toughness: Made from difficult materials, composite doors can hold up against weather condition components.
  • Energy Efficiency: Their insulation homes help to maintain indoor temperature levels.
  • Security: Equipped with multi-point locking systems, they provide boosted safety.
  • Flexibility: Available in a range of designs and surfaces to match any home aesthetic.

The Renovation Process for Composite Doors

Refurbishing a composite door involves several actions, all targeted at bring back the door's initial appeal while improving its durability. Below is a summary of the typical renovation procedure.

Step 1: Inspection and Assessment

Before any work starts, experts will carry out a thorough examination of the door. This step consists of:

ComponentAssessment Focus
Surface FinishLook for scratches, chips, or fading
Seals and GasketsEvaluate integrity to avoid drafts
Locks and HardwareEnsure functionality and security
Frame ConditionTry to find damage that might affect door fit

Step 2: Cleaning and Preparation

Once the evaluation is complete, the next step is to clean up the door completely. This step involves:

  • Removing dirt, gunk, and any existing paint or finishes.
  • Using suitable cleaner to prevent harming the composite material.
  • Preparing the surface area for any needed repairs or ending up.

Step 3: Repairs and Replacements

If the inspection reveals any locations needing repair, experts will resolve these problems:

  • Minor Repairs: Filling in scratches or dents with proper fillers.
  • Seal Replacement: Installing new weather condition seals and gaskets as required.
  • Hardware Replacement: Upgrading locks, manages, or hinges that reveal wear.

Step 4: Refinishing

Refinishing plays an essential function in bringing life back to a composite door:

  • Painting or Staining: Experts will use a high-quality paint or stain ideal for composite products.
  • Protective Coating: Applying a UV-resistant finish to protect versus fading and damage.

Step 5: Final Inspection

After the renovation is total, a final examination will ensure whatever is in perfect order. This includes checking the door's performance, aesthetics, and total efficiency.

Cost of Composite Door Renovation

The cost of renovating a composite door can differ substantially based on several elements:

FactorApproximated Cost Range
Inspection Fee₤ 50 - ₤ 100
Repair Costs₤ 100 - ₤ 300
Refinishing Costs₤ 200 - ₤ 800
Overall Renovation Costs₤ 350 - ₤ 1200

Understanding these costs can help homeowners budget plan for their renovation jobs efficiently.

Often Asked Questions

1. How frequently should I remodel my composite door?

Composite doors normally require renovation every 5 to 10 years, depending upon weather condition exposure and wear.

2. Can I paint my composite door myself?

While it's possible to paint a composite door, working with professionals ensures a top quality surface and better toughness.

3. Are there any problems that can not be fixed?

Severe structural damage may need a full door replacement instead of repair. A professional assessment will figure out the best strategy.

4. What types of surfaces can be used on composite doors?

Premium paint, stains, and protective coverings are usually recommended for composite doors. Experts can assist you on the best options.

5. How can I preserve my composite door post-renovation?

Routine cleansing, examining seals, and ensuring proper hardware functionality will assist preserve your composite door and prolong its life.
